The Los Angeles Regional Water Quality Control Board is the lead agency overseeing Shell Oil Company in the environmental investigation of the Carousel Tract. The Water Board has initiated the environmental investigation as a result of potentially significant and harmful contamination in the soils and groundwater underlying the Carousel Tract. The City does not have local regulatory authority and will assist the Water Board and other supporting state and county agencies in a thorough and rapid environmental investigation.

Excavation Pilot Testing
The city of Carson Building and Safety division is currently reviewing plans to issue grading permits for the excavation pilot testing for the following six properties:
- 24533 Ravenna Avenue
- 24736 Ravenna Avenue
- 24612 Neptune Avenue
- 24715 Neptune Avenue
- 24432 and 24502 Marbella Avenue
Portions of the front or rear yards will be excavated to a depth of approximately 10 feet. Upon completion of the excavation, the holes will be filled and compacted with clean soil.

Residential Sampling Activity
As of April 20, 2012, the completed Residential Sampling Activity is as follows:
- 264 homes have been screened for methane. (93%)
- 264 homes have had soils sampled and vapor probes installed. (93%)
- 260 homes have had sub-slab soil vapor probes sampled (91%).
- 75 homes have had indoor air sampling. (26% completed)
There are a total of 285 homes within the Carousel neighborhood. For further information, please visit the following website and view the City Council reports for updates on the environmental investigation.

On March 11, 2011, the Regional Board issued Final Cleanup and Abatement Order (CAO) No. R4-2011-0046, directing Shell Oil Company to assess, monitor, and cleanup and abate total petroleum hydrocarbons and other contaminants of concern discharged to soil and groundwater at the former Kast Property Tank Farm. |
